Employers in East Noble, OK, are increasingly adopting stringent drug testing policies to ensure a safe and productive work environment. The majority of companies perform pre-employment and random drug tests, encompassing both urine and hair follicle testing. Local businesses align their policies with guidelines provided by the Oklahoma Department of Labor.
These efforts are mirrored by the focus on workplace education programs, where employers seek to educate employees about the risks of substance abuse. Reduction programs and Employee Assistance Programs (EAPs) have seen increased enrollment, indicating a community shift towards addressing issues early and systematically.
The government of East Noble, OK, alongside Jackson County authorities, has implemented several initiatives to combat drug problems. These initiatives include increased funding for drug prevention programs and partnerships with local organizations. The Oklahoma Bureau of Narcotics provides resources and assistance to local law enforcement in East Noble to effectively address the drug crisis.
Additionally, state-level efforts led by the Oklahoma Department of Mental Health and Substance Abuse Services focus on community outreach and education. Programs aimed at youth prevention in East Noble have been buttressed by these collaborative efforts, which aim to reduce initial drug use and educate the population on the dangers of substance abuse.
Recent local law enforcement efforts in East Noble, OK, have led to multiple successful drug busts, highlighting the city's commitment to clamping down on illegal drug activities. In collaboration with the Jackson County Sheriff's office, East Noble police recently dismantled a methamphetamine distribution network responsible for a substantial influx of drugs in the region.
Drug-related events, such as 'Take Back Days,' coordinated by local authorities and supported by federal initiatives like the DEA's National Prescription Drug Take Back Day, have also been instrumental in raising awareness and reducing the availability of unused medications. These events have provided East Noble residents with safe and anonymous disposal options.
